ci: simplify pipeline — docker build handles full Maven build internally
Remove separate Maven stage. The multi-stage Dockerfile already runs mvn inside a Linux container, so Windows Jenkins just runs docker build/push. Server-side docker login pre-configured; deploy only needs docker pull. Co-Authored-By: Claude Sonnet 4.6 <noreply@anthropic.com>
